Casa Verde was incredible! Watching the sunset from the pool with a cocktail in hand is a must. The experience and accommodations are first rate. From the moment i sent my initial inquiry - which was answered in less than an hour by the owner, to the gracious property manager and grounds keepers, the property and exclusivity is unmatched. Great fruit trees on property and banana leaves to steam fresh caught fish in. The monkeys, parrots and iguanas serenade every morning through open doors and windows. Being high above the dust and activity of Mal Pais is awesome. Lots to see and do nearby, but a 4x4 vehicle you will not be able to do without. Roads are rough (loved every second of it).

Casa Verde is well maintained and has a washer/dryer. We used it daily! It gets pretty dirty down in Mal Pais and it was nice to have the option of doing your own laundry.

We cooked dinner most nights and traveled with our own spices. The kitchen is well appointed but like most vacation rental homes, you will need to bring your own condiments, spices, sugar/flour etc. or purchase at the store. Tons of markets from which to choose - we favored the Super Ronny #2 in Santa Teresa. It wasn't the closest, but had the best selection of meats and produce.

Lots of great restaurants about 15 minutes from the house in Mal Pais. We liked the "Sodas" that catered to the locals and were much less expensive than the other restaurants. Sodas are the Costa Rican equivalent to a taco shack- really great food, cheap prices. We had casado everyday for lunch at many different places in Santa Teresa, Mal Pais, Manzanillo and Montezuma.

We surfed for a week in Playa Hermosa (Santa Teresa). This spot is great for beginners as it has a nice long sand bar and pretty good waves for more experienced regardless of tide. Rented boards from Nalu - as recommended by the property manager. She was right on! Nalu was great, offered nice boards at a good price.

Would stay at this property again - all around amazing experience!

We just returned from our 16 day trip to CR and for our first week, we stayed at Casa Verde.

Words cannot describe the tranquility and beauty of this property. We initially arrived after dark to the house so it wasn't until the next morning when we woke up and could actually see the view of the ocean and the valley that this house sits upon; we nearly wept.

Based on the website's information, the house was everything we expected and more! The drive up to the gated community from the main road takes about 7 minutes and I definitely wouldn't try to do it without a 4x4 of some sort. It's a rough road but doesn't have scary cliffs or anything. The house lies at the top of a very large hill and the valley below is breathtaking. The one other house that you can see in the distance doesn't spoil the view whatsoever.

Each of the two bedrooms are decorated beautifully and the whole house sort of has that inside-outside feel because the main living area and dining room are actually outside on the covered veranda. You truly are with nature here. There were several troops of howler monkeys that would move through the valley and around the property; we loved waking up to them. The main living area has huge rafters on the roof that lent their space to a few creatures, which we loved. Bats, house geckos, iguanas, and butterflies all shared the space with us. Totally cool.
Around the property, we saw howler monkeys, lizards of all types, we had a resident coati, and too many types of birds to count but a flock of parrots would fly by every morning at about 6am.

For our meals, we drove down to MalPais, which takes about 10 minutes. Some times we had to search a bit for places that were open but, by far, our favorite restaurant there was Casa Del Mar. Pasta Basta and Zwart(breakfast) are also must-eats. No matter where you go in MalPais, the locals and the tourists are all extremely friendly and helpful, even if you don't speak Spanish (we didn't).
The other nice aspect is that the gated community provides a shortcut to Montezuma. It's about a 15min drive to get there. We did the tour to Tortuga Island which was only $50 for a full day per person and an amazing experience.

If you are looking for a place to get away and RELAX, I promise, Casa Verde will not let you down. Email the owner and he'll likely respond within minutes. I'm already recruiting travel partners to go back as soon as possible!
